In this video, we share our experience visiting two significant sites from one of history's darkest chapters: 01:22 Tuol Sleng Genocide Museum (S21): Once a high school, this site was transformed into the notorious S21 security prison by the Khmer Rouge. We explore the preserved buildings and learn about the estimated 20,000 people imprisoned, tortured, and documented here before being sent to their deaths. 03:33 Choeung Ek Genocidal Center (The Killing Fields): Just outside Phnom Penh, this peaceful orchard holds the brutal history of mass executions. We walk the grounds, guided by audio accounts, visiting the mass graves and the memorial stupa filled with skulls, a stark reminder of the over 1 million lives lost during the regime. While difficult, visiting these sites offers crucial insight into the atrocities committed between 1975 and 1979 and serves as a powerful memorial to the victims.
